John 17:12-23
12 During my time here, I protected them by the power of the name you gave me. I guarded them so that not one was lost, except the one headed for destruction, as the Scriptures foretold.
13 “Now I am coming to you. I told them many things while I was with them in this world so they would be filled with my joy.
14 I have given them your word. And the world hates them because they do not belong to the world, just as I do not belong to the world.
15 I’m not asking you to take them out of the world, but to keep them safe from the evil one.
16 They do not belong to this world any more than I do.
17 Make them holy by your truth; teach them your word, which is truth.
18 Just as you sent me into the world, I am sending them into the world.
19 And I give myself as a holy sacrifice for them so they can be made holy by your truth.
20 “I am praying not only for these disciples but also for all who will ever believe in me through their message.
21 I pray that they will all be one, just as you and I are one—as you are in me, Father, and I am in you. And may they be in us so that the world will believe you sent me.
22 “I have given them the glory you gave me, so they may be one as we are one.
23 I am in them and you are in me. May they experience such perfect unity that the world will know that you sent me and that you love them as much as you love me.

Democrat or Republican? Liberal or Conservative? Pro-life or Pro-choice? Israeli or Palestinian? Muslim, Croat, or Serb? Rich or poor? Coke or Pepsi? Chevy or Ford? There are thousands of categories or choices that divide people. Some are incredibly important. Some are more polarizing than others. Some are just plain silly. (Just don't tell a Chevy truck owner that I said so.) Many people are just plain sick and tired of all the division and disagreement and disunity that exists in the world. "Why can't we all just get along?" they cry. There ought to be some place where people aren't divided. There ought to be some way for people of different backgrounds, classes, customs, and temperaments to come together and get along. There is. It's called the church. God's will for the church is that it be the one place-the one body, actually-where people aren't divided along lines of race, nationality, gender, class, or denominational lines. He wants you and me and all Christians everywhere to be one with each other, just as the Father is one with the Son, and the Son is one with the Spirit, and the Spirit is one with the Father. Although the three members of the Godhead are different in some ways, they are one in nature, in purpose, in purity, in holiness. Jesus, the Son, expressed his desire for unity among his followers. He said to God, the Father: "My prayer for all of them is that they will be one, just as you and I are one, Father-that just as you are in me and I am in you, so they will be in us, and the world will believe you sent me" (John 17:21). The more you and I reflect God's standard of unity, the more people will believe that Jesus is the Christ, the Son of God. Our unity with each other-particularly because it's so rare in this sinful world-can be a testimony to the power of God.

REFLECT: Why do you think unity among Christians will make non-Christians more likely to believe the gospel? When was the last time you spent time with a Christian of another race, culture, or denomination? How can you do so more often?

ACT: Watch this week for the number "1" (on signs, advertisements, etc.), and use its appearance to remind you of the importance and benefit of unity.

PRAY: "Thank you, God, that you are one with your Son, Jesus, and that Jesus is one with your Holy Spirit."
